    Comparison of biochemical parameters among DPP4 inhibitor users and other oral hypoglycaemic drug users: a cross-sectional study from Anuradhapura, Sri Lanka

    Background: Higher efficacy of incretin-based therapies for type 2 diabetes mellitus has been reported from Asia. Pancreatitis and hepatitis have also been suspected to occur due to dipeptidyl peptidase-4 inhibitor (DPP4I) treatment. The present study aims at comparing selected biochemical parameters among DPP4 inhibitor users and other oral hypoglycaemic drug users. Methods: Patients were recruited from the State Pharmaceutical Corporation, Anuradhapura, Sri Lanka, for a comparative cross-sectional study. Two groups were involved: \u201cDPP4I\u201d user group (n = 63) and \u201cother oral hypoglycaemic\u201d user group (n = 126). Mann-Whitney U test was performed to find a significant difference (p < 0.05) in the distributions of HbA1C, pancreatic amylase, serum lipase, AST and ALT levels between the two groups. Results: Contradicting to previous Asian studies, distribution of HbA1C (p = 0.569) between anti-diabetic regimes with and without DPP4 inhibitors showed no significant difference. Also, amylase (p = 0.171), AST (p = 0.238) and ALT (p = 0.347) failed to show significance. However, lipase was significantly (p = 0.012) high in the DPP4I group. Conclusion: The study showed a significantly higher lipase level among the DPP4I users in comparison to other oral hypoglycaemic drug users, and possible reasons were discussed

    Comparison of medication adherence between type 2 diabetes mellitus patients who pay for their medications and those who receive it free: a rural Asian experience

    Background: Treatment plans fail if patients have poor medication adherence. Our aim was to compare medication adherence, reasons for non-adherence, and satisfaction with community support among type 2 diabetes mellitus patients who pay for their medications and those who receive it free. Methods: A descriptive cross-sectional study was conducted at Anuradhapura, Sri Lanka, among patients who were on oral anti-diabetic drugs for at least 3 months. They were grouped into two: universal-free group and fee-paying group. Three different scales were used to score medication adherence, reasons for non-adherence, and satisfaction with community support. Fisher\u2019s exact test was performed to determine if there was a significant difference between the two groups (p < 0.05) concerning medication adherence and satisfaction with community support. Results: The median (IQR) medication adherence scores for fee-paying group and universal-free group were 3 (2-3) and 3 (3-3), respectively; the median (IQR) scores for satisfaction with community support were 5 (2\u20136) and 4 (4\u20136), respectively. Both the adherence and the satisfaction failed to show a significant difference between the two groups. Forgetfulness, being away from home, complex drug regime, and willingness to avoid side effects were common reasons of non-adherence for both the groups. Conclusions: There was no significant difference in medication adherence between the universal-free group and feepaying group, despite of having a significantly different income. The universal-free health service would be a probable reason

    Tuberculosis induced autoimmune haemolytic anaemia: a systematic review to find out common clinical presentations, investigation findings and the treatment options

    Abstract Background Tuberculosis induced autoimmune haemolytic anaemia is a rare entity. The aim of this study was to explore its common presentations, investigation findings and treatment options through a systematic review of published reports. Methods PubMed, Trip, Google Scholar, Science Direct, Cochrane Library, Open-Grey, Grey literature report and the reference lists of the selected articles were searched for case reports in English on tuberculosis induced auto-immune haemolytic anaemia. PRISMA statement was used for systematic review. Quality assessment of the selected reports was done using the CARE guidelines. Results Twenty-one articles out of 135 search results were included. Thirty-three percent of patients were reported from India. More than half had fever and pallor. The mean haemoglobin was 5.77 g/dl (SD 2.2). Positive direct coombs test was seen in all patients. Pulmonary tuberculosis (43%) was most prevalent. Twenty-nine percent of patients needed a combination of anti-tuberculosis medicines, blood transfusion and steroids. Higher percentage of disseminated TB induced AIHA (67%) needed steroids in comparison to the other types of TB induced AIHA (13%). Conclusions Rarer complications of tuberculosis such as auto-immune haemolytic anaemia should be looked for especially in disease-endemic areas. Blood transfusion and steroids are additional treatment options along with the anti-tuberculosis medicines

    Acetylcholinesterase inhibitor insecticides related acute poisoning, availability and sales: trends during the post-insecticide-ban period of Anuradhapura, Sri Lanka

    Abstract Background Acetylcholinesterase inhibitor insecticides (AChEIIs) were used extensively in the agrarian region of Anuradhapura for the past few decades. As a result, the region faced a heightened risk of toxicity. Carbaryl, carbofuran, chlorpyrifos, dimethoate, and fenthion were the five hazardous AChEIIs banned from Anuradhapura in 2014. Assessment of post-ban trends in acute poisoning will reveal the impact of the ban. Data on availability and sales of remaining AChEIIs will guide towards preventive measures against related toxicities. Methods Cross-sectional surveys were conducted at Anuradhapura district of Sri Lanka. Details related to acute AChEII poisoning were sorted from the Teaching Hospital Anuradhapura. Main insecticide vendors in Anuradhapura were surveyed to find information on availability and sales of AChEIIs. Chi-square for goodness of fit was performed for trends in acute poisoning and sales. Results Hospital admissions related to acute AChEII poisoning have declined from 554 in 2013 to 272 in 2017. Deaths related to acute AChEII poisoning have declined from 27 in 2013 to 13 in 2017. Sales of all five banned AChEIIs had reduced by 100%. Sales of the remaining AChEIIs were declining, except for acephate, phenthoate, and profenofos. However, one of the top selling, most frequently abused carbosulfan, had the highest risk of toxicity. Chi-square for goodness of fit showed a significance (P < 0.001) between the trends of hospital admissions for acute AChEII poisoning and the sales related to AChEIIs. Conclusions Hospital admissions related to acute poisoning was declining along with the overall sales of remaining AChEIIs, during the post-AChEII ban period. Nevertheless, future vigilance is needed on the remaining AChEIIs to predict and prevent related toxicities

    Red blood cell acetylcholinesterase activity among healthy dwellers of an agrarian region in Sri Lanka: a descriptive cross-sectional study

    Abstract Background Assessment of acetylcholinesterase-inhibitor insecticide (AChEII) toxicity depends on the measurement of red blood cell acetylcholinesterase (RBC-AChE) activity. Its interpretation requires baseline values which is lacking in scientific literature. We aim to find the measures of central tendency and variation for RBC-AChE activity among dwellers of Anuradhapura, where the use and abuse of AChEIIs were rampant for the last few decades. Methods A descriptive cross-sectional study with a community-based sampling for 100 healthy non-farmers (male:female = 1:1) was done using pre-determined selection criteria. Duplicate measurements of RBC-AChE activity were performed according to the modified Ellman procedure. Pearson’s correlation and regression analysis were sort for RBC-AChE activity against its possible determinants. Results RBC-AChE activity had a mean of 449.8 (SD 74.2) mU/μM Hb with a statistical power of 0.847. It was similar to values of “healthy controls” from previous Sri Lankan toxicological studies but was low against international reference value [586.1 (SD 65.1) mU/μM Hb]. None of the possible determinants showed a significant strength of relationship with RBC-AChE activity. Conclusion The baseline RBC-AChE activity among people of Anuradhapura is low in comparison with international reference values. This arises a need to find a causative mechanism
